Israel's Siege on Gaza "Morally Indefensible" : FO Minister

Foreign Office Minister Chris Bryant MP Tuesday labelled Israel's siege of Gaza "morally indefensible", in a parliamentary debate on the Goldstone Report.

Responding to comparison's made by Jeremy Corbyn MP of Israel's policy towards Gaza and the UK police tactic of "kettling" protesters via mass detentions, Bryant stated that it was "morally indefensible to 'kettle' the Palestinian people."

Israel has blockaded the Gaza Strip since the summer of 2007, preventing freedom of movement for the Palestinian people and allowing the delivery of only the most basic of humanitarian goods. Reconstruction materials, desperately needed in the wake of a conflict that damaged or destroyed 50,000 homes, have largely been prevented from entering the territory.

The Goldstone Report, commissioned to investigate the December to January fighting between the Israeli military and Palestinian groups, labelled the siege "collective punishment" and a potential war crime.
